Scouts Canada eLearning
Every Scouter is required to complete Wood Badge training within their first year as a volunteer, and eLearning makes it convenient and easy to gain the knowledge you need to plan and deliver a quality Scouting program.
Wood Badge training will require approximately 5-6 hours to complete, but the benefits will extend throughout your Scouting years. You’ll gain the skills you need to support competent and confident section leadership – a key enabler of safe, high quality programs. You’ll gain tips on how to perform as a Scouter more efficiently, saving you time and effort in the long run. In essence, Wood Badge Training will transfer the knowledge you need to provide the best possible experiences for Scouting youth – core to delivering on our Brand Promise to our members, their parents, and the Canadian public.
One final benefit of eLearning, of course, is that you can complete it anywhere, any time, and at your own pace.
The Scouts Canada eLearning platform has now been fully integrated with myscouts.ca.
To access the eLearning platform:
- Login to myscouts.ca;
- Select Training in the myscouts menu; and
- Click on the eLearning button.
